Output ac8a67aa4de953c1f28ac17b2091c13fb9e4c311473206720fa6ea1fbc8eb0ba:1

value
74000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72b422a14e9df4c8873b964fa48ec14030c0884 OP_EQUAL
address
3MJj2SKiF8BDDN67HYYJTmWZYP72ZgHVgU
transaction
ac8a67aa4de953c1f28ac17b2091c13fb9e4c311473206720fa6ea1fbc8eb0ba
confirmations
106251
spent
true